Petitions for Cancellation of An Active Trademark Registration Can Now Be Done Via The TTAB Center

The United States Patent and Trademark Office announces a new option for Trademark Trial and Appeal Board (also referred to as the “TTAB”) petitioners to file a petition for cancellation via the Office’s new system, the TTAB Center, in order to initiate a cancellation proceeding. The United States Patent and Trademark Office Issues Interim Processes for Patent Trial and Appeal Board Workload Management

On March 26, 2025, the Acting Under Secretary of Commerce for Intellectual Property and Acting Director of the United States Patent and Trademark Office issued a Memorandum to all Patent Trial and Appeal Board Judges (“PTAB Judges”).
